Parents need to know that louisa may alcotts semiautobiographical little women, originally published in 1868, is a lengthy, beloved american classic that tells the story of the four march sisters growing up in boston during and after the civil war, as they wait for their father to return home. With the widespread school, library, and bookstore closures and many schools transitioning to remote learning, little, brown books for young readers has received numerous requests from teachers, administrators, librarians and booksellers across the country asking for permission to post readings of books online for their students to access.
